Having lunch in the bustling shopping area, I felt like having curry today because it's a bit cool. I noticed CoCo Ichibanya and decided to go in. It was crowded during lunchtime, but luckily I managed to find a seat at the counter as soon as the previous customer left. I ordered the Pork Cutlet Curry with vegetables, with normal spiciness. It was my first time having CoCo Ichibanya curry in a while. The 300g rice portion was satisfying. Mixing the curry was a delightful experience. The crispy cutlet was also delicious. The addition of potatoes, carrots, and green beans as toppings was a nice touch. I decided to add some extra spicy seasoning halfway through, which elevated the spiciness level and made it even better. The attentive service from the staff was also commendable. Overall, it was a great meal.

Targeted menu entry. Summer vegetable curry with chicken (¥980) with spice level 2 (+¥44), crispy chicken cutlet (+¥326), and salad set (+¥140) ordered. Upon taking a closer look at the menu, the variety of options and toppings made it difficult to choose, showcasing the addictive nature of the place with something new to enjoy daily. First up was the salad, with the option to choose your own dressing, adding to the appeal of the place. The spicy aroma and the scent of frying oil in the air inside the restaurant only increased the appetite. The awaited curry arrived and the presentation was impressive. As mentioned in other reviews, the spice level in the curry was not overpowering but added a refreshing touch. The chicken, though not extremely crispy, was still hot and delicious, complementing the curry well. Despite the small space, customers kept coming in even past 9 PM on a weekday, indicating its enduring popularity. Yes, it was delicious. Thank you for the meal.

Cocoichi, a popular curry chain on Kita-dori, offers their first Chicken Leg Soup Curry for 1150 yen including tax. The rice comes in a regular portion of 200g. The spiciness level is 4 out of 10, with an additional 84 yen for extra spiciness. It took 15 minutes from ordering to serving. The ingredients include chicken leg, boiled egg, potatoes, burdock, broccoli, carrots, eggplant, and cabbage. The chicken was tough and lacked flavor, but the soup itself was delicious. The soup lacked depth but had just the right amount of saltiness. Not recommended for those looking for authentic soup curry, but a good option if the price is a concern. The added bonus of having Fukujinzuke and soup curry together was enjoyable. Thank you for the meal.
